BilgePump Posted June 17, 2014 Author Share Posted June 17, 2014 So do I need both a tank shutoff switch as well as the electronic shutoff valve (right before the pump) to replace the ASOV? Link to comment
AZDesertRat Posted June 17, 2014 Share Posted June 17, 2014 According to page 9 of the Spectrapure manual they suggest keeping the ASOV if you do not use a solenoid valve, something has to stop the flow. Personally I use the solenoid valve on my system since I like a positive shutoff but it works either way. Link to comment
